Britton, mips assembly language programming pearson. An appendix is included that covers the download, installation, and basic use of the qtspim simulator. Read download mips assembly language programming pdf pdf. Mips assembly language programming download pdfepub. This book starts from basic information needed for mips assembly language programming using mars ide, the text covers mips arithmetic and logical operators, memory model of mips, control structures, recursion, and array, and so on in grater details. Free mips architecture simulatorenables easy observation of the memorymapped io, interrupts and exception processing, and delayed loads and delayed branches for a pipelined implementation allows students to learn how to write the fundamental assembly language code to implement the classical io algorithms. Read online mips assembly language programming lagout book pdf free download link book now.
Mips, assembly, procedural programming, binary arithmetic, computer. Mars has been tested in the softpedia labs using several industryleading security solutions and found to be completely clean of adwarespyware. However this book was not written simply as a book on assembly language programming. This book provides a technique that will make mips assembly language programming a relatively easy task as compared to writing intel 80x86 assembly language code. Buy mips assembly language programming book online at low. However, formatting rules can vary widely between applications and fields of interest or study. Mips assembly language programming using qtspim open. This book was written to introduce students to assembly language programming in mips. Mips assembly language programming 97801420441 by britton professor emeritus, robert and a great selection of similar new, used and collectible books available now at great prices. Mar 24, 2006 this is a free online book in assembly language programming of the mips processor. Mips assembly language programming download ebook pdf. This site is like a library, use search box in the widget to get ebook that you want.
Mips assembly language programming by britton professor. Mips assembly language programming by robert britton. This site is like a library, you could find million book here by using search box in the header. This text provides a technique that will make mips assembly language programming a relatively easy task as compared to writing complex intel x86 assembly language code. For freshmansophomorelevel courses in assembly language programming, introduction to computer organization, and introduction to computer architecture, this text gives an understanding of how the read more. The assembler converts assembly language statements into machine code. Users of this book will gain an understanding of the fu. This book is targeted for use in an introductory lowerdivision assembly language programming or computer organization course. The scope of this text addresses basic mips assembly language programming including.
Maybe you have knowledge that, people have look numerous period for their favorite books next this mips assembly language programming solutions, but stop happening in harmful downloads. Mips assembly language programming cs50 discussion and project book daniel j. As you landed on this page because you want to learn assembly language programming in mips instruction set architecture. As with all assemblylanguage programming texts, it covers basic. Users of this book will gain an understanding of the fundamental concepts of contemporary computer architecture, starting with a reduced instruction set computer risc. This book was written to introduce students to assembly language. This site is like a library, you could find million book. It covers basic operators and instructions, subprogram calling, loading and storing memory, program control, and the conversion of the assembly language program into machine code. The design has also been licensed to manufacturers, such as the sony corporation for its early playstation range of games consoles and handhelds, and can. May 28, 2003 buy mips assembly language programming book online at best prices in india on. This book will discuss the mips architecture and perhaps more importantly mips assembly programming. For information on assembling and linking an assembly language program, see the mips riscompiler and c programmer s guide.
Introduction to mips assembly language programming free. Buy mips assembly language programming book online at best prices in india on. The purpose of this text is to provide a simple and free reference for university level programming and architecture units that include a brief section covering mips assembly language programming. This is a course in assembly language programming of the mips processor. Inspire a love of reading with prime book box for kids discover delightful childrens books with prime book box, a subscription that delivers new books every 1, 2, or 3 months new customers receive 15% off your first box. Click download or read online button to get mips assembly language programming book now.
Can i take a name of some good book to learn mips assembly. Mips assembly language programming offers students an understanding of how the functional components of modern computers are put together and how a computer works at the machinelanguage level. The skills learned, as a mips assembly language programmer, will facilitate learning other more complex assembly languages if the need ever arises. Read download mips assembly language programming pdf. It assumes that youre already familiar with assembly language, acquainted with the registers and instructions of the 8088, and with the use of one of the popular pc assemblers.
Mips assembly language programming download pdfepub ebook. For example, value and reference types are covered in detail, as are call stacks and heap memory. Introduction to mips assembly language programming leanpub. An understanding of computer architecture needs to begin with the basics of modern computer organization. Much of the material in this text existed for years as a jumble in my own mind. The purpose of this book is to fill a niche in teaching mips assembly language in that it does not simply teach assembly language programming, but attempts to show higher level language and computer organizational principals. Mips assembly language programming ucsb computer science. Mips assembly language programming robert britton professor emeritus on. Download pdf mips assembly language programming free. For information on assembling and linking an assembly language program, see the mips riscompiler and c programmers guide.
The book begins with a datapath diagram that shows a simple implementation of the mips architecture, consisting of a register file, an alu, a memory. Download pdf mips assembly language programming free online. Welcome,you are looking at books for reading, the mips assembly language programming, you will able to read or download in pdf or epub books and notice some of author may have lock the live reading for some of country. There are a number of excellent, comprehensive, and indepth texts on mips assembly language programming. Mars mips assembler and runtime simulator an ide for mips assembly language programming mars is a lightweight interactive development environment ide for programming in mips assembly language, intended for educationallevel use with patterson and hennessys computer organization and design. Mips assembly language programming solutions thank you completely much for downloading mips assembly language programming solutions. Fundamentals of mips programming in assembly language udemy. Mips assembly language programming robert britton download. This section is a quick tutorial for mips assembly language programming and. This text is intended to be more than a book about assembly language programming, but to extend assembly language into the principals on which the higher level languages are built. Well, assemblylanguagetuts has compiled the complete tutorials just for beginners, who are fighting with assembly programming. As with all assemblylanguage programming texts, it covers basic operators and instructions, subprogram calling, loading andstoring memory, program control, and the conversion of the assembly language program into machine code. Plenty of general purpose registers are provided 32 for mips mips assembly language programming offers students an understanding of how the functional components of modern computers are put together and how a computer works at the machinelanguage level. Introduction to mips assembly language programming download.
Data representation, mips tutorial, function environments and linkage. This book provides an understanding of how the functional components of modern computers are put together and how a computer works at the machinelanguage level. Mips assembly language programming by robert britton professor emeritus and a great selection of related books, art and collectibles available now at. Kann gettysburg college, 2015 this book introduces students to assembly language. Mips assembly language programming by britton professor emeritus, robert prentice hall, 2003 paperback paperback britton professor emeritus on.
This book introduces students to assembly language programming in mips. All books are in clear copy here, and all files are secure so dont worry about it. About this book this book describes the assembly language supported by the riscompiler system, its syntax rules, and how to write assembly programs. Mips assembly language programming by britton professor emeritus, robert pre. Microprocessor without interlocked pipeline stages abbreviated mips is a computer processor architecture developed by mips technologies, and is often used when teaching assembly language programming in computer science courses. Mars is a lightweight interactive development environment ide for programming in mips assembly language, intended for educationallevel use with patterson and hennessys computer organization and design feb. Welcome to the mips assembly language programming tutorials. If youre interested in cpu architecture, you might consider gettin. Fundamentals of mips programming in assembly language. Users of this book will gain an understanding of the fundamental concepts of contemporary computer architecture, starting with a reduced instruction set. Mips assembly language programming edition 1 by robert. Introduction to mips assembly language programming open.
Mips assembly language programming download ebook pdf, epub. As with all assembly language programming texts, it covers basic operators and instructions, subprogram calling, loading and storing memory, program control, and the conversion of the assembly language program into machine code. Since that time, the mips paradigm has been so influential that nearly every modernday processor family makes some use of the concepts derived from that original research. Free assembly books it, programming and computer science. Even programming languages are written to enhance the ability of the person writing. Introduction to mips assembly language programming by.
It emphasizes the topics needed for study of computer architecture. Mips assembly language programming computer science. Buy mips assembly language programming 01 by britton professor emeritus, robert isbn. Therefore it need a free signup process to obtain the book. Read online mips assembly language programming computer science book pdf free download link book now. As with all assembly language programming texts, it covers basic. The mips architecture embodies the fundamental design principles of all contemporary reduced instruction set computer risc architectures. Dec 31, 2015 introduction to mips assembly language programming. Pdf introduction to mips assembly language programming. The design has also been licensed to manufacturers, such as the sony corporation for its early playstation range of games consoles. Mips assembly wikibooks, open books for an open world.
This is a free online book in assembly language programming of the mips processor. There are many textbooks covering both mips and pdp11, or indeed any other assembly language you choose to learn. Description this book was written to introduce students to assembly language programming in mips. The mips architecture embodies the fundamental design principles of all contemporary risc architectures. Introduction to mips assembly language programming openlibra. Mips assembly language programming the mips architecture embodies the fundamental design principles of all contemporary reduced instruction set computer risc architectures. Michael abrashs graphics programming black book by michael abrash coriolis group books a book for game developers and serious assembly language programmers.
Introduction to mips assembly language programming. It explores the technology behind the popular doom and quake 3d games, and explains optimized solutions to 3d graphics problems from texture mapping, hidden surface removal, etc. Mips assembly language programming lagout pdf book. Mips assembly language programming 97801420441 by britton professor emeritus, robert and a great selection of similar new. Everyday low prices and free delivery on eligible orders. Mips assembly language programming 1st edition pearson. Can i take a name of some good book to learn mips assembly language programming.
1006 1242 1299 228 589 740 1296 1183 1143 1357 632 957 1493 1059 839 457 852 1238 1146 760 1368 354 531 607 1461 1372 215 77 1306 1168 120 682 232 1490 1098 21